Gini Reticker is a highly accomplished and celebrated documentary producer and director, boasting an impressive array of prestigious accolades, including a coveted Academy Award nomination and multiple Emmy wins, a testament to her exceptional skill and dedication to her craft.

Her impressive directional credits include the highly acclaimed documentary Pray the Devil Back to Hell, a production that garnered widespread critical acclaim and recognition for its thought-provoking and emotionally powerful storytelling.

Furthermore, Reticker co-created and executive produced multiple seasons of the esteemed PBS series Women, War and Peace, a groundbreaking and influential documentary series that explores the complex and multifaceted experiences of women in conflict zones around the world.

In her role as director, Reticker brought her unique perspective and expertise to bear on two of the series' most gripping and emotionally resonant episodes, The Trials of Spring and Peace Unveiled, which have been widely praised for their nuanced and compassionate portrayal of the human cost of war and conflict.

As a highly respected and accomplished documentary filmmaker, Ellen Reticker has earned a reputation as a pioneering feminist filmmaker, boasting a diverse and impressive body of work that has garnered widespread critical acclaim and numerous prestigious awards.

Notably, her Oscar-nominated short film Asylum showcases her ability to craft compelling narratives that captivate audiences and spark important conversations.

In addition, Reticker's Emmy-winning documentary Ladies First and her Emmy-nominated film A Decade Under the Influence further demonstrate her mastery of the documentary form and her commitment to creating high-quality, engaging films that resonate with diverse audiences.

Moreover, Reticker co-founded Fork Films, a production company dedicated to amplifying the voices and perspectives of women, alongside the renowned filmmaker Abigail Disney, and has served as its Chief Creative Officer.

Throughout her illustrious career, Reticker has been recognized as a champion of women in the documentary field, having executive produced over twenty award-winning films that have made a significant impact on the industry and beyond.
